How many large prawns is 100g?

4 min read
According to reputable seafood wholesalers, a large prawn typically weighs between 30 and 44 grams, meaning a standard 100g serving contains approximately 2 to 3 large prawns. However, the exact count depends heavily on the specific grading, the cooking method used, and whether the prawns are sold with heads and shells on or off.

How many pieces of jumbo shrimp is 3 ounces?

3 min read
According to the FDA, a standard 3-ounce serving of seafood is generally recommended, but the number of jumbo shrimp in that serving can vary based on sizing. For a 3-ounce serving of cooked jumbo shrimp, you can expect to have approximately 5 to 7 pieces.
